Joel's Shop needs to maintain 15% of its sales in net working capital. Joel's is considering a 4-year project which will increase sales from their current level of $130,000 to $150,000 the first year and
To $165,000 a year for the following three years. What amount should be included in the project
Analysis for net working capital in year four of the project?
